The operation of an overfeed stoker involves feeding coal from above the grates. This design is specifically intended to allow a continuous and controlled flow of coal onto the combustion surface. By feeding the coal from above, it helps maintain a sufficient bed of fuel on the grates, allowing for efficient combustion and better utilization of the heat generated.

In an overfeed stoker system, the coal descends onto the grates where air is introduced from below, promoting efficient combustion. This method is advantageous because it facilitates the burning of the coal while minimizing unburned carbon losses. Additionally, this approach allows for easier ash removal since the ash produced during combustion can fall through the grates.

The other options refer to different methods of feeding coal or processes that are not characteristic of an overfeed stoker. For example, feeding coal from below the grates is typical of underfeed stokers, while high-pressure injection and preheating of coal are not standard practices associated with overfeed stokers.
